[PATCH] PATCH: libata. Add ->data_xfer method



We need to pass the device in order to do per device checks such as
32bit I/O enables. With the changes to include dev->ap we now don't have
to add parameters however just clean them up. Also add data_xfer methods
to the existing drivers except ata_piix (which is in the other block of
patches). If you reject the piix one just add a data_xfer to it...
